SAP(SAP) - 2023 Q4 - Annual Report

Revenue Performance - The company reported cloud revenue as a key performance measure, which includes fees from software as a service (SaaS), platform as a service (PaaS), and infrastructure as a service (IaaS) [31] - Total revenue is measured in both actual and constant currencies, with cloud revenue and software support revenue being the two largest revenue streams [33] - Total revenue for 2023 reached €31,207 million, a 5.7% increase from €29,520 million in 2022 [68] - Cloud revenue increased to €13,664 million in 2023, a 19.5% rise from €11,426 million in 2022 [68] - Software licenses revenue decreased to €1,764 million in 2023, down 14.2% from €2,056 million in 2022 [68] Profitability Metrics - Operating profit (non-IFRS) is used to measure overall operational process efficiency and business performance [39] - Non-IFRS operating profit for 2023 was €9,548 million, reflecting a 12% increase compared to €8,516 million in 2022 [69] - Operating profit for 2023 was €5,787 million, with a non-IFRS operating profit of €8,722 million, reflecting a significant increase from €7,989 million in 2022 [70] - Profit after tax from continuing operations reached €3,600 million, resulting in a non-IFRS profit of €5,850 million, compared to €4,517 million in 2022 [70] - Attributable profit to owners of the parent was €3,634 million, with a non-IFRS profit of €5,880 million [70] Cash Flow and Expenses - Free cash flow is a key measure for managing overall financial performance, calculated as net cash from operating activities minus capital expenditures [44] - Free cash flow for 2023 was €5,093 million, up 16% from €4,388 million in 2022 [63] - Operating expenses (non-IFRS) totaled €22,485 million in 2023, a decrease of 11.4% from €25,420 million in 2022 [69] - Total operating expenses for 2023 were €25,420 million, with non-IFRS adjustments leading to a total of €22,485 million [71] - Research and development expenses (non-IFRS) were €5,613 million in 2023, a reduction from €5,629 million in 2022 [69] - Research and development costs amounted to €6,324 million, with a non-IFRS adjustment resulting in €5,613 million [71] Future Outlook and Strategic Initiatives - The company anticipates that starting in 2024, SAP S/4HANA Cloud revenue will be replaced by the Cloud ERP Suite revenue metric [34] - The company plans to stop excluding share-based payment expenses from operating profit (non-IFRS) starting in 2024 [60] - The company aims to enhance transparency in financial reporting by providing both IFRS and non-IFRS measures for better comparability [67] - The company aims to achieve carbon neutrality in its operations by 2023, with net carbon emissions being a key performance metric [51] - The company plans to use gross greenhouse gas emissions as a new metric starting in 2024 to measure emissions along the value chain as part of its Net Zero by 2030 commitment [51] Customer and Employee Metrics - The Customer Net Promoter Score (NPS) is used to assess customer loyalty, with adjustments made in 2023 to improve data quality [45] - The Employee Engagement Index is measured as a percentage of favorable responses from employee surveys, reflecting employee satisfaction and commitment [50] Tax and Earnings - The effective tax rate for 2023 was 32.6%, slightly higher than 32.0% in 2022 [70] - Basic earnings per share from continuing operations increased to €3.11 in 2023, up from €2.80 in 2022 [70] Other Financial Metrics - The total contractually committed cloud revenue (TCB) and current cloud backlog (CCB) are valuable indicators of the company's go-to-market success [37] - Constant currency measures indicate that revenue growth was impacted by currency fluctuations, with adjustments made for foreign currency effects [62] - The operating margin for 2023 was 18.5%, compared to 20.6% in 2022 [70] - The company incurred restructuring costs of €215 million, which were fully adjusted in the non-IFRS figures [71]
